Team Wet Spot//// YAR

Good day today.

1st set was a bust

#2 called in a good sized male. Came in hard left and saw me get the rifle ready and just wouldn't stop. I had a split second left gave about a dog lead and let fly. Heard the thump and it went down. 125 yards and trotting ended up making a perfect hit, that doesn't happen often.
 


Set #3 Forgot my foxpro at #2 and had to go back about 1/2 mile to get it.  :bash:  Left Bighorns2Bushytails to do a set while I was gone. He called in a couple but never saw them. I saw them when I was on the way back. They hung on him about 5-600 yards out and he never knew they were there.

Set#3 Called one in at about 230 or so. He just sat and stared so I started the pup in distress and he started coming in. He got to about 170 from me and probably 220-230 from BH2BT and busted him.  :bash: He just froze and stared. BH2BT missed his shot into the sun. Sometimes things just don't work out.

Set#4 We split up again hoping to get BH2BT into position for a good shot. Started calling and immediately got challenged. I challenged right back, waited a bit and started yelping. Damn dog came in from my hard right running. He stopped at the edge of a draw at 200+. I hoped he'd come straight up to me but he decided to cut across to downwind me. I knew I should have just shot but I didn't and he did evedently wind me. never saw him again.

Set #5 Bust

Set #6 Called for quite a while here. Got some howls but I was losing my patience and the wind was picking up and it was getting damn cold. I was getting ready to bag it and off to our right 6-700 yards out is a pair. They're coming towards us (sort of) and I'm not sure what to think. They get to the top of the network of brows we were on and turn towards us coming at a pretty good clip. Not running but definately committed. As soon as the big male who was in back goes out of site I switch up to prone. She tops the crest of the hill out in front at 200ish and just stops and stares. I'm just letting the foxpro run with pup in distress turned pretty low. She waits a while then hubby shows up behind her. BH2BT says he'll take #2 but the #1 starts pretty much making a charge and he's hanging back. I can't let her get closer because if she gets out of sight in 30 yards or so she make take a right and get into our wind. I bark to stop her and she does at 135. I wait a second (I guess) hoping #2 is stopped and I shoot. I downed her and #2 bolts. I kind of screwed BH2BT out of his dog but I geuss I got the fever. SORRY MAN!!!!! I OWE YOU!!!!
 

Set #7 is a bust and we go home.

Great day today. Saw 8 called in 6, got busted by one  :bash: and missed two. :bash: Neither miss was by any means a gimme.  :bash:
